What Is a Half Cavity Iron and How Does It Differ from Other Types of Irons?
Key aspects of half cavity irons include their construction, which typically involves a forged or cast body with a strategically placed cavity that optimizes weight distribution. This design helps lower the center of gravity, promoting a higher launch angle and increased distance. Additionally, half cavity irons often feature a thinner top line compared to full cavity-back models, which appeals to players looking for a more traditional look at address. The smaller cavity also gives these irons a slightly more responsive feel, allowing for better feedback on miss-hits.
The relevance of half cavity irons is evident in their ability to cater to golfers who desire improved control without sacrificing forgiveness. They are particularly beneficial for players who can generate sufficient swing speed and are looking to refine their shot-making skills. What Are the Main Benefits of Using a Half Cavity Iron for Golfers?
The main benefits of using a half cavity iron for golfers include enhanced forgiveness, improved trajectory control, and better distance consistency.
- Enhanced Forgiveness: Half cavity irons feature a design that distributes weight more evenly throughout the clubhead. This design helps to minimize the effects of off-center hits, allowing golfers to achieve better results even when they don’t strike the ball perfectly.
- Improved Trajectory Control: The cavity back design allows for a lower center of gravity, which can help golfers achieve higher launch angles. This feature is particularly beneficial for players looking to optimize their ball flight, making it easier to carry hazards and land softly on the greens.
- Better Distance Consistency: With a larger sweet spot, half cavity irons can provide more consistent distance across various strikes. Golfers can rely on their half cavity irons to deliver a predictable distance, which is crucial for effective course management and lower scores.
- Increased Playability: The combination of forgiveness and trajectory control makes half cavity irons more playable for a wide range of skill levels. Whether a beginner or an experienced player, golfers can benefit from the ease of use and adaptability that these clubs offer.
- Enhanced Feedback: Unlike full cavity irons, half cavity designs offer a bit more feedback on shots, allowing golfers to better understand their impact. This feedback helps players make necessary adjustments to their technique and improve their overall game.
